In spite of the fact that slavery is illegal today in every part of the world, slavery still exists in virtually every country. Including the United States. During the days of the Trans-Atlantic slave trade, slaves were very expensive. In today's money, a slave could cost $40,000.
But slaves today are bought and sold illegally for less then $100 average. They are considered "disposable" people and can be found in most major industries from fabric weaving, to chocolate production to shoe sewing.
